On E edge of a ridge in pastureland. Poorly preserved subcircular cashel (27m E-W; 25m N-S) defined by a collapsed drystone wall. A cattle byre has been built in the interior. Abutting the cashel wall at NNE is an annexe (13.5m E-W ;12.5m N-S).
Compiled by: Galway Archaeological Survey, UCG
